Challenges of Implementing Quarantine in High-Density Environments
Implementing quarantine in high-density environments presents significant logistical challenges. Overcrowding complicates efforts to isolate infected individuals effectively, increasing the risk of virus transmission. Limited space can hinder the establishment of designated quarantine zones, often forcing compromises that reduce efficacy.
Resource allocation also becomes a critical concern. Densely populated areas may lack sufficient healthcare facilities, personnel, and quarantine supplies, making enforcement difficult. Ensuring compliance requires substantial investment, which may not be immediately available during public health crises.
Enforcement of quarantine laws raises social and ethical issues. Maintaining order without infringing on individual rights demands careful balancing. In high-density settings, community resistance and distrust may undermine quarantine measures, further complicating enforcement efforts.
Lastly, monitoring and surveillance pose considerable difficulties. The mobility within crowded areas, coupled with limited technological infrastructure, hampers contact tracing and compliance enforcement. These factors collectively challenge the effectiveness of quarantine enforcement in densely populated environments.

Case Studies of Quarantine Enforcement in Urban Settings
Several urban areas have implemented quarantine enforcement measures with varying degrees of success. Notable examples demonstrate how legal frameworks and community cooperation influence outcomes during public health crises.
In Singapore, strict enforcement of quarantine laws involved close monitoring and technological tracking, leading to high compliance rates. The government’s clear legal stance and penalties effectively minimized non-compliance.
In Italy’s Lombardy region, authorities faced challenges due to densely populated neighborhoods, making enforcement complex. Community engagement and mobile health teams helped improve adherence, illustrating the importance of local strategies.
In New York City, quarantine enforcement combined legal measures with public communication campaigns. The city employed fines and legal action against violators, which reinforced community awareness and accountability.
Key lessons from these case studies include:
- The effectiveness of technological tools in monitoring compliance.
- The importance of community involvement for enforcement success.
- The need for legal clarity and transparent communication to ensure adherence.
legal Penalties and Compliance Incentives
Legal penalties and compliance incentives are critical components in enforcing quarantine measures in densely populated areas. Strict enforcement often involves fines, detention, or legal action against individuals or entities who violate quarantine protocols, ensuring deterrence and accountability. Such penalties reinforce adherence by emphasizing the legal consequences of non-compliance.
Conversely, compliance incentives may include public recognition, community benefits, or reduced restrictions for those who follow quarantine laws diligently. These incentives can motivate voluntary cooperation, especially in high-density settings where enforcement challenges are significant. A balanced approach combining penalties and incentives helps sustain effective quarantine enforcement.
It is important to acknowledge that excessive penalties may raise human rights concerns, potentially undermining public trust. Ethical enforcement strategies should therefore prioritize proportionality and fairness, aligning legal measures with human rights standards. This comprehensive approach enhances compliance while respecting individual dignity during quarantine enforcement in densely populated areas.
